代码编辑器下载:你的编程利器
代码编辑器下载:你的编程利器
在当今的编程世界中,选择一个合适的代码编辑器至关重要。无论你是初学者还是经验丰富的开发者,一个好的代码编辑器不仅能提高你的工作效率,还能提供丰富的功能来帮助你更好地编写和管理代码。本文将为大家介绍几款热门的代码编辑器下载,并提供一些下载和使用建议。
Visual Studio Code
Visual Studio Code(简称VS Code)是由微软开发的一款免费、开源的代码编辑器。它支持几乎所有主流的编程语言,并且拥有丰富的插件生态系统。你可以在官网上直接下载VS Code,支持Windows、macOS和Linux系统。VS Code的特点包括:
- 智能代码补全:通过IntelliSense提供代码补全建议。
- 调试功能:内置强大的调试工具,支持多种语言的调试。
- Git集成:直接在编辑器内进行版本控制操作。
- 丰富的插件:从主题到语言支持,插件市场提供了大量的扩展。
Sublime Text
Sublime Text是一款轻量级的文本编辑器,深受开发者喜爱。它虽然不是免费的,但提供无限期的评估版,用户可以先体验再决定是否购买。Sublime Text的特点包括:
- 速度快:启动和响应速度非常快。
- 多行编辑:支持同时编辑多行代码。
- 包管理:通过Package Control安装插件。
- Goto Anything:快速跳转到文件、符号或行。
Atom
Atom是GitHub开发的一款可定制性极强的文本编辑器,号称“21世纪的文本编辑器”。它是开源的,用户可以根据自己的需求进行深度定制。Atom的特点包括:
- 开源:社区贡献的插件和主题非常丰富。
- 跨平台:支持Windows、macOS和Linux。
- 内置Git和GitHub集成:方便进行版本控制。
- Teletype:实时协作编辑功能。
JetBrains系列
JetBrains公司提供了一系列专业的IDE(集成开发环境),如IntelliJ IDEA(Java)、PyCharm(Python)、WebStorm(JavaScript)等。这些IDE虽然不是传统意义上的轻量级代码编辑器,但它们提供了非常强大的功能:
- 智能代码分析:提供代码检查、重构建议等。
- 集成开发环境:包括调试、测试、版本控制等功能。
- 插件支持:丰富的插件市场,满足不同开发需求。
Notepad++
Notepad++是一款免费的源代码编辑器和Notepad替代品,适用于Windows操作系统。它支持多种编程语言的语法高亮,具有轻量、快速的特点:
- 多文档界面:支持同时编辑多个文件。
- 插件扩展:通过插件扩展功能,如FTP、宏等。
- 正则表达式搜索:强大的搜索和替换功能。
下载和使用建议
在下载代码编辑器时,建议:
-
根据需求选择:如果你需要一个轻量级的编辑器,Sublime Text或Notepad++可能更适合;如果你需要强大的IDE功能,JetBrains系列或VS Code会是更好的选择。
-
试用版:许多编辑器提供试用版或免费版,先体验一下再决定是否购买或长期使用。
-
插件和主题:下载后,根据个人喜好和工作需求安装插件和主题,提升编辑体验。
-
学习资源:利用官方文档和社区资源学习如何更好地使用这些编辑器。
-
安全性:从官方网站或可信的第三方下载,以避免恶意软件。
总之,选择一个合适的代码编辑器不仅能提高你的编程效率,还能让你在编程过程中感到更加愉快。希望本文能帮助你找到适合自己的代码编辑器,并在编程之路上走得更远。